- Gard (8/5): Barebones, but functional and accommodating. - Key exchange was simple with a keybox right outside the door.
Simple and somewhat bare necessities accommodation, but I didn't really need more. Standard of the living room/bedroom was good and clean. A small kitchenette with oven gave me what I needed to make my own meals.
Excellent public transport opportunities almost right outside the door, with service going until late at night, and only about 10-15 minutes to Essen Hauptbahnhof.
With the apartment facing a public park, there were little traffic noise to speak of, even with the window open. No elevator, so stairs were a bit difficult with my overweight suitcases. Luckily only one flight to climb.
No standing shower, but the bathtub had a shower head so I could sit down for a quick "shower". Exposed wiring connection for the bathroom lamp was a bit worrying, as it was directly opposite the tub and there were no showercurtains.
The refrigerator compressor could be a bit noisy, but didn't run much.
No aircondition, luckily the outside air was cool enough with the window open. Would imagine summertime could be a problem.
